Archify
The README section "Archify" states: Archify is an agent skill for Raven, Cursor, Claude Code, Codex CLI, and OpenCode. Give it a system description or repository; get an interactive, shareable technical map.
Archify
The README section "Archify" states: - Open it and present , five technical diagram types, four visual presets, dark/light themes, and optional finite motion - Review architecture changes before merge , compare two validated snapshots as Before / Delta / After, with exact added, removed, changed, moved, and rerouted facts - Every interaction stays grounded , search nodes, optionally open revision-verified source, trace upstream/downstream authored reach and exact routes, compare roles, and play guided stories without inventing topology - One file, ready to trust and share , typed JSON IR and deterministic checks produce self-contained HTML plus PNG, SVG, WebM, and 1200×630 share cards
